Transaction 3e3795042cd152e07aeaf9a702d19eeb68f43982a87c74cb40ec8d7cbf0128f6

2 Input
2 Outputs
  • 3e3795042cd152e07aeaf9a702d19eeb68f43982a87c74cb40ec8d7cbf0128f6:0
  • value  805448
    address  37orWKSmY2kRPLbUQRxVnWHBWSS9tV6nVM
  • 3e3795042cd152e07aeaf9a702d19eeb68f43982a87c74cb40ec8d7cbf0128f6:1
  • value  1349991
    address  3HTSH1GudViwoyETkvdY68pPb1U2TPXSGY